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Develop and deliver an organisation-wide marketing and communications strategy
  • Provide strategic marketing input to organisational planning and growth initiatives
  • Lead and develop the marketing team, fostering a high-performance culture
  • Manage marketing budgets, planning, reporting and performance evaluation
  • Strengthen Living Better's brand, reputation and market positioning
  • Ensure consistent messaging across all digital and offline channels
  • Lead integrated campaigns, stakeholder communications and public affairs activity
  • Support CEO communications and engagement with key partners, funders and local authorities
  • Lead SEO, paid media, email marketing and social media strategies
  • Oversee website performance, user experience and digital optimisation

Requirements

  • Proven experience in a senior marketing or communications leadership role
  • Strong track record of developing and delivering marketing strategies
  • Experience across digital marketing, social media, email marketing, SEO, and analytics
  • Excellent leadership, stakeholder management and communication skills
  • Experience using Google analytics, SaaS, CRM and CMS platforms
  • Strong project management and budget management capabilities
  • Data-driven approach with a focus on measurable outcomes

Preferred

  • Experience within the charity, public, health or wellbeing sectors
  • WordPress, Divi, Beacon CRM or similar platform experience
  • Canva or Adobe Creative Suite skills
  • PR, partnership, or fundraising campaign experience

Living Better

Our mission is to improve the health, happiness and wellbeing of people across Cambridgeshire and Peterborough. We believe that being active is for everyone, and we’re here to support individuals, families and communities to move more, feel better, and live healthier lives.
